Channel catfish (Ictalurus punctatus) at a geothermal heated fish farm in southern Idaho. The channel cat is North America's most numerous catfish species. They are the most fished catfish species in the United States. They have a fine white meat and sweet flavor, which has made them a popular and rapidly growing aquaculture species.
